Key Models And Technologies
Digital Inverter And Energy Efficiency
Samsung Digital Inverter technology modulates compressor speed to maintain stable temperatures while reducing energy consumption. This approach minimizes on/off cycling, which lowers electricity use and extends unit life. In the U.S. market, many models achieve high SEER-like ratings for cooling efficiency and offer efficient dehumidification modes as well.
Wind-Free And Comfort Features
Wind-Free technology distributes cool air softly through thousands of micro-holes, creating a comfortable environment without direct cold drafts. Complementary features include precise sensor-driven cooling, Auto Comfort Control, and adaptive fan speeds that respond to room conditions. These technologies are designed to improve perceived comfort while preserving energy efficiency.
Smart And Connectivity Capabilities
Samsung air conditioners increasingly include smart controls via Wi-Fi, compatibility with voice assistants, and remote monitoring through mobile apps. This enables scheduling, troubleshooting prompts, and maintenance reminders. In the U.S., these features integrate with popular ecosystems and offer remote diagnostics to support service needs.
Performance And Energy Efficiency Considerations
Performance in the United States is influenced by climate zones, building insulation, and window orientation. Inverter-driven units adapt to varying loads, delivering consistent cooling without peak electrical spikes. For buyers, comparing SEER-like efficiency ratings, cooling capacity (BTU), and Energy Star eligibility helps determine long-term operating costs. Proper sizing is critical; an undersized unit cannot meet high-demand periods, while an oversized unit may cycle excessively and reduce comfort.

Installation, Sizing, And Maintenance
Professional installation is recommended for split systems to ensure correct refrigerant charge, drainage, and electrical connections. Sizing should consider room size, ceiling height, and shading. Regular maintenance includes filter cleaning or replacement, condenser cleaning, and checking indoor and outdoor unit safety clearances. Samsung units often provide service indicators and diagnostic tools to assist homeowners, but manufacturer-certified technicians remain the best option for complex service needs in the United States.
Common Issues And Troubleshooting Tips
Frequent concerns involve reduced cooling performance, unusual noises, and error codes displayed on the unit. Quick checks include verifying that air filters are clean, outdoor coils are free of debris, and the thermostat setting matches the desired temperature. If issues persist, consult the Samsung support portal for model-specific codes and contact options. For critical refrigerant problems, only a licensed HVAC technician should handle the service due to safety and regulatory requirements.

Maintenance Best Practices For Optimal Longevity
Adhering to a routine maintenance schedule preserves efficiency and comfort. Regularly clean or replace filters every 1–3 months, inspect outdoor units for debris, and schedule professional inspections annually. Seasonal maintenance, including refrigerant and electrical checks, helps prevent performance dips during peak cooling months. Keeping the indoor environment clean and ensuring proper airflow around the unit supports sustained efficiency in the United States climate.
